vim

noun
/vɪm/

Meaning

energy and enthusiasm

Example Sentences

She performed the dance with great vim and vigor.

Example Expressions

vim and vigor

Synonyms

energy, enthusiasm, vitality, spirit, zest

Antonyms

lethargy, fatigue, weakness

Collocations

vim and vigor, full of vim, youthful vim, vim for life
